Job Description

BozemanOutpatientSurgery Center, is seeking a motivated Part-Time Registered Nurse OR Circulator to join our team.

BozemanOutpatientSurgery Center is a fast-paced, multi-specialty ambulatory surgery center.We believe health and care are inseparable. We focus on offering a high quality, service-oriented environment for our patient’s surgical procedures. Our facility is accredited by The Joint Commission.

The Registered Nurse OR Circulator provides nursing care and service during surgery cases. The Registered Nurse OR Circulator will be responsible for positioning the patient, prepping the patient, and circulating the case.

This is Part Time position in which will require working 2 - 10 hour shifts/week.

  • Monday-Friday work schedule
  • NO Nights, NO Weekends, NO Holiday work hours
  • NO call required

About United Surgical Partners International, Inc

United Surgical Partners International (USPI) is the largest ambulatory surgery platform in the country and operates ambulatory surgery centers and surgical hospitals. The company was founded in 1998 with a promise to deliver high-quality, lower-cost solutions to the communities it serves by forming collaborations with other like-minded institutions and physicians. USPI is part of Tenet Healthcare, which provides access to additional resources and a greater network of care. For more information, please visit www.uspi.com.
